dehorned
Dehorned refers to an animal that has had its horns removed or has been rendered hornless. In livestock management, dehorning or disbudding is practiced to reduce injuries among animals and to improve safety for handlers, as well as to facilitate housing, transport, and feeding. Disbudding describes preventing horn growth in young animals before the horn tissue develops fully; dehorning describes the removal of horns after they have formed.
